WebOct 10, 2024 · In English law, the purpose of an award of damages for breach of contract is to compensate the injured party for loss, rather than to punish the wrongdoer. The general rule is that damages should (so far as a monetary award can do it) place the claimant in the same position as if the contract had been performed ( Robinson v Harman (1848) 1 Ex ... hybrid business meansWebCorrect measure of damages in suit for breach of contract to repair automobile would be the cost of repair of the defect. Proper measure of damages for breach of contract to sell land is the difference between the contract price and the fair market value at the time of the breach.
